Three students from Bulls College Prep were shot when they walked home from school on Friday afternoon, officials said. The shooter remains in general.

The victims, a 15-year-old girl and boys aged 15 and 16, were shot on a sidewalk in the 200 block of South Hoyne around 2.45 pm, according to the Chicago police. CPD did not release any information about where the gunfire came from or what the shooter looked like.

The older boy was found near Hoyne and Gladys with a Scot wound on his shoulder, while officers found the girl in a building vestibule with a shot wound on her left leg. They were both in good condition, according to CPD. The police said that the younger boy was brought to the Stroger hospital in a private car. He was in a serious condition with a shot wound on his right leg.

All three victims are students of Chicago Bulls College Prep, 2040 West Adams.
